Eaton's Electrical Group is seeking a Welding & Fabrication Technician for its Panelboard / Switchboard Satellite Operation. The position will be located in Windsor, CT. Position Overview: The Welding & Fabrication Technician will layout, make templates, cut off, punch, drill & tap, and weld. Load steel into machines to cut, form and/or bend to various configurations, operating machinery including punch/laser machine, press brake, manual shear, powered industrial vehicles as requested. Off load excess steel material. Must wear proper steel fabrication PPE, such as steel toe shoes, safety glasses, material handling gloves, ear protection and long sleeve shirt or cut resistant slip-ons. In this function you will: You will support work assignments from supervisor or production control system. You will input information into data collection system as required. You will work from manufacturing information, sketches, drawings, oral and written instructions. You will perform routine maintenance on machinery such as oiling, manual clamp adjustments, and clamp/finger replacement You will use material handling equipment, including powered industrial vehicles, to move product and supplies. May lift and carry up to 50 lbs. and push or pull up to 100 lbs. occasionally with assistance. You will be familiar with all materials used to perform job functions. Follow material safety data sheet instructions. You will utilize calipers, gauges, or other measuring devices to assure engineering standards to the .001 precision level.
